How to compare files in eclipse

Additional Details

2019-12 (4.14), 2020-03 (4.15), 2020-06 (4.16), 2020-09 (4.17)

Screenshots Metrics

DateRankingInstallsClickthroughs
July 2022NA0 (0%)4
June 2022NA0 (0%)6
May 2022NA0 (0%)6
April 2022NA0 (0%)6
March 2022NA0 (0%)3
February 2022NA0 (0%)2
January 2022NA0 (0%)11
December 2021NA0 (0%)3
November 2021NA0 (0%)8
October 2021NA0 (0%)2
September 2021NA0 (0%)13
August 2021NA0 (0%)8
View Data for all Listings

Errors

Unsuccessful Installs in the last 7 Days: 0

Download last 500 errors (CSV)

External Install Button

By adding the following code below to your website you will be able to add an install button for Code Compare.HTML Code:

<a href="http://marketplace.eclipse.org/marketplace-client-intro?mpc_install=4868429" class="drag" title="Drag to your running Eclipse* workspace. *Requires Eclipse Marketplace Client"><img style="width:80px;" typeof="foaf:Image" class="img-responsive" src="https://sg.cdnki.com/how-to-compare-files-in-eclipse---aHR0cHM6Ly9tYXJrZXRwbGFjZS5lY2xpcHNlLm9yZy9zaXRlcy9hbGwvdGhlbWVzL3NvbHN0aWNlL3B1YmxpYy9pbWFnZXMvbWFya2V0cGxhY2UvYnRuLWluc3RhbGwuc3Zn.webp" alt="Drag to your running Eclipse* workspace. *Requires Eclipse Marketplace Client" /></a>


Markdown Syntax:

[![Drag to your running Eclipse* workspace. *Requires Eclipse Marketplace Client](https://marketplace.eclipse.org/sites/all/themes/solstice/public/images/marketplace/btn-install.svg)](http://marketplace.eclipse.org/marketplace-client-intro?mpc_install=4868429 "Drag to your running Eclipse* workspace. *Requires Eclipse Marketplace Client")

Output:

5 days ago To compare two files in Eclipse, first select them in the Project Explorer / Package Explorer / Navigator with control-click. Now right-click on one of the files, and the following context menu will appear. Select Compare With / Each Other.. Just select all of the files you want to compare, then open the context menu (Right-Click on the file) and choose Compare With, Then select …

Show details

See also: File

You can use the Eclipse UI perspective to compare data sets or members to see what records are inserted, deleted, matched, or changed.

You can use the Eclipse UI perspective to compare data sets or members to see what records are inserted, deleted, matched, or changed.

This article describes how to use the compare feature to address the following scenario.

You are a quality assurance engineer responsible for testing business applications. The development team has provided you with a performance enhancement to a program used to update customer information for the billing and collection system. The program has been altered for efficiency but is expected to produce the same result as the original program version. In addition to measuring the performance improvement, you need to verify that the output from the new program is the same as the output from the old program.

  1. Open the Directory List view in the perspective.

  2. Select from the Directory List view one of the data sets or members that you want to compare.

  3. Right-click the data set or member and select Utilities, Compare.The Compare Data Set Utility wizard opens.

  4. Complete the following fields on the Old Data Set page, or verify that the prefilled information is correct:

    • Specifies the name of the first data set that you want to compare.

    • Specifies the name of the member that you want to compare. Perform a wildcard search to select more than one member. Enter an asterisk (*) to compare all members. This field is only active when comparing members in a PDS.

  5. Specify the name of the data set and member as on the New Data Set page. This identifies data set and member that you want to compare to the Old data set. If you are comparing members in a PDS, the Old and New data sets must both contain the members you want to compare.

  6. Set the following options, which produce the best report for this scenario. Use F1 help to learn about the other settings available that best meet your needs for a specific compare report.

    • Mismatched

  7. (Optional) Specify a layout for the old and new data sets. You can select Use old data set layout to use the specified layout for both the old and new data sets. Do one of the following in the Old data set layout and the New data set layout groups:

    • Select from the drop-down list a layout displayed in your Layout view.

    • Specify the layout data set and member name.

  8. Click Next.A summary page shows the options that you have selected.

  9. Click Finish.The summary results of your compare are displayed in the Report view.

The compare report summary displays in the Report view after completing the Compare wizard. The summary report shows the names of the data sets and members you compared, the layout used, the options you selected, the number of records compared, and whether the compare was successful.

Click the View Detailed Report icon (

How to compare files in eclipse
) to view the detailed compare report. When you close the compare report summary, the detailed compare report closes and is deleted.

The following detailed compare report shows the compare of two data sets where record 59 in the OLD data set was deleted in the NEW data set. The SUMMARY REPORT section displays below the details. The summary shows that 60 of 61 records matched, no records were changed or inserted, and one record was deleted.

000001 1CA File Master Plus V9.0 Page 1 000002 System CA11 2013-05-28 15:42 000003 000004 Compare Report Old File AD1DEV.FMMVS90.DEMO.BASE.CUSTFILE Key pos = 2 Key len = 7 000005 New File JOHSA08.FMMVS90.DEMO.BASE.CUSTFILE 000006 000007 Key=0000867 000008 FFFFFFF 000009 0000867 000010 Delete Old Rec #59 000011 Old Record Length = 160 000012 Pos *----------FIELD NAME-------------* FORMAT *---+----1----+----2----+----3----+----4 000013 1 03 CUST-REC-TYPE C 1 1 000014 2 03 CUST-ID C 7 0000867 000015 9 03 CUST-NAME C 15 JAN SMITH 000016 24 03 CUST-STREET C 18 48 WILLOW WAY 000017 42 03 CUST-CITY C 12 NEW HAVEN 000018 54 03 CUST-STATE C 2 CT 000019 56 03 CUST-ZIP-CODE C 10 06032-1234 000020 56 05 CUST-ZIP N 5 6032 000021 61 05 FILLER C 1 - 000022 62 05 CUST-ZIP-PLUS N 4 1234 000023 66 03 CUST-MNTHLY-PYMNTS(1) PS 3.2 988.41 000024 69 03 CUST-MNTHLY-PYMNTS(2) PS 3.2 224.30 000025 72 03 CUST-MNTHLY-PYMNTS(3) PS 3.2 8.06 000026 75 03 CUST-MNTHLY-PYMNTS(4) PS 3.2 503.24 000027 78 03 CUST-MNTHLY-PYMNTS(5) PS 3.2 91.25 000028 81 03 CUST-MNTHLY-PYMNTS(6) PS 3.2 243.57 000029 84 03 CUST-MNTHLY-PYMNTS(7) PS 3.2 301.21 000030 87 03 CUST-MNTHLY-PYMNTS(8) PS 3.2 602.49 000031 90 03 CUST-MNTHLY-PYMNTS(9) PS 3.2 847.23 000032 93 03 CUST-MNTHLY-PYMNTS(10) PS 3.2 663.22 000033 96 03 CUST-MNTHLY-PYMNTS(11) PS 3.2 113.42 000034 99 03 CUST-MNTHLY-PYMNTS(12) PS 3.2 237.21 000035 102 03 CUST-TOTAL-MNTHLY-PYMNTS PS 5.2 94170.78 000038 000039 000040 S U M M A R Y R E P O R T 000041 000042 Old Records Processed 61 000043 New Records Processed 60 000044 000045 Records Matched 60 000046 Records Changed 0 000047 Records Inserted 0 000048 Records Deleted 1 000049 000050 000051 000052 The following files are compared: 000053 000054 DDNAME DSN 000055 OLD => SYSUT1 AD1DEV.FMMVS90.DEMO.BASE.CUSTFILE 000056 NEW => SYSUT1N JOHSA08.FMMVS90.DEMO.BASE.CUSTFILE 000057 000058 Mismatched records (inserts, deletes, and changes) are reported. 000059 Record display is single record formatted with line(s) for each field. 000060 For changed records, only fields which are different are displayed. 000061 1CA File Master Plus V9.0 Page 2 000062 System CA11 2013-05-28 15:42 000063 000064 Compare Report Old File AD1DEV.FMMVS90.DEMO.BASE.CUSTFILE Key pos = 2 Key len = 7 000065 New File JOHSA08.FMMVS90.DEMO.BASE.CUSTFILE